The difference between hash routing and history routing in vue
In Vue.js, Hash routing uses URL fragments to represent routing status, which is compatible with old browsers but is not good for SEO; History routing uses URL paths to represent routing status, which is only compatible with modern browsers and is good for SEO; select Which mode depends on application requirements and SEO needs.
The difference between Hash and History routing in Vue.js
Vue.js provides two routing modes: Hash routing and History routing. They have important differences in URL handling, browser compatibility, and SEO.
URL processing
-
#Hash routing: Use URL fragments (#) to represent routing status, such as
#my- page
. -
History routing: Use the real URL path to represent the routing status, such as
/my-page
.
Browser Compatibility
- Hash Routing: Compatible with all modern browsers, including no support for the HTML5 History API old browser.
- History routing: Only compatible with modern browsers that support the HTML5 History API, such as Chrome, Firefox, Safari and Edge.
SEO (Search Engine Optimization)
- Hash Routing: Will not create new entries in browser history , not conducive to SEO.
- History routing: Creates new browser history entries, which is good for SEO because search engines can crawl and index different routing states.
Other differences
-
Back button: When using Hash routing, the back button will trigger
popstate
Events; when using the History route, it triggers thepopstate
andhashchange
events. - Page refresh: When using Hash routing, refreshing the page will not trigger routing update; when using History routing, refreshing the page will trigger routing update.
- Performance: History routing generally performs better than Hash routing because it does not require any modification to the URL.
Which routing mode to choose
Which routing mode to choose depends on the specific requirements of the application being developed. If you need compatibility with older browsers or if you don't need SEO, you can use Hash routing. Otherwise, the History route should be used for better performance and SEO.

The watch option in Vue.js allows developers to listen for changes in specific data. When the data changes, watch triggers a callback function to perform update views or other tasks. Its configuration options include immediate, which specifies whether to execute a callback immediately, and deep, which specifies whether to recursively listen to changes to objects or arrays.

Vue component passing values is a mechanism for passing data and information between components. It can be implemented through properties (props) or events: Props: Declare the data to be received in the component and pass the data in the parent component. Events: Use the $emit method to trigger an event and listen to it in the parent component using the v-on directive.
